  4. if you've left everything at its default settings, then no, you haven't missed anything out.

    ImgBurn only burns whats in the original input file, so good sound and good audio = good sound and good audio on the disc you create.

    Its most likely to do with either the blank media you've been using, or possibly your standalone player doesn't like that type/brand/format of media

    can you post a log file from ImgBurn for us to see. click on VIEW and put a check against LOG , this opens another window if you cant already see it , then when you've done a burn copy and paste it into here.

    also if you can copy and paste what is in the right hand window in ImgBurn as well, that helps.

    you can google your standalone players make and model to confirm what formats it will play ( may be handy for later)

  5. Getting TOC information, means the drive is trying to read the "Table of contents" on the disc.

    it would seem that your drive is struggling to read these discs your using , which probably/possibly means theres a fault with the drive itself. although you say it worked with v2.1.0.0

    Are you tyring to use discs that have failed to burn before ?, these would have an incomplete TOC on them ?? causing the drive to struggle to read the TOC

    Have you cleaned the lense in the drive ?

    Is your other writer drive ok ?, will that burn discs still ?

    bottom line, Its your media, its about as low in quality as a dashounds nuts to the floor

    anything with CMC dye in is crap im afraid.

     

    For Dual layer you MUST use Verbatims , NOTHING ELSE is any good , see my signature below

    In your case the writer struggled to write to the 2nd layer on the disc ( Layer 1) ( the first layer is called Layer 0 )

    Layer 1 is sectors 1913760 - 3697695 ( in red further up) and your drive struggled at sector 1914080 , which is just near the start of burning the 2nd layer

     

    Your firmware is up to date , so thats good, but you need to bin those discs and buy verbatims :thumbup:

    even if you do get to burn to them, they probably wont be readable by any drive afterwards anyway
